FBC eblast August 30, 2018 www.fbcwoodbury.org Dr. Chuck Kelley, President of New Orleans Baptist Theological Seminary, said in a recent chapel message: We are NOBTS: we have conversations with people, not conversations about people. If we just refused to talk about a person until we have first talked to that person, many, even most of the problems I ve seen through the years in church life would never have lifted off the launch pad. Jesus says in Matthew 18 that if you have an issue with a brother or sister, you should first go to him or her privately. If we took that to heart in the church, from leaders to laypeople, it would build our understanding and love for each other, prevent unnecessary judgment and misunderstanding, and turn many of our problems into blessings. It can be powerfully tempting just to have conversations about people, but determine to have conversations with people instead it ll make you obedient to Jesus and bless you, them, and your church.
